Architecture of the Status App
Architecture Decision Records (ADRs)
- docs/adr/0001-android-status-go-as-a-service.md: Android architecture where
status-goruns in a separate Service process and the UI talks to it via Binder IPC.
Top level architecture
This shows the flow from the UI all the way to the backend.
We do not use servers. status-go is what our app considers the backend and as such, it has it's own local databases to contain the user data.

Standard Nim module
This is the way how most of our Nim modules are assembled.

Nim Middleware architecture
Shows how the Nim modules are connected. The Nim modules are more often than not associated with the UI view they represent.
